As already mentioned above, its just a straight list that we can already see from just going to the achievements page.
What would be useful in a real guide:
1. The actual titles you get from each achievement, if there is one. Because not every achievement gives you a title and its unclear as to exactly what you need to do to get some of the more obscure titles.
-- For example, I saw someone with the title [Do Not Disturb]. This is an AWESOME title but I have no idea which achievement or series of achievements you have to do in order to get it.
2. If the achievement requires plat purchased items, OR gold purchased items, how much it will cost you in plat, or estimated gold cost to get the achievement/title.
-- For example, I have gold cap, but not all my characters have more than 1 auction slot. The zillionaire title would not be achievable unless I purchased more slots for those characters, like 10 for 75 plat i think? The bottle neck for that achievement is generally the gold cap or the plat for multiple auction slots. Information like this would make this a legit guide and get you lots of thanks.
